Hi

Just an update on what is happening with the claire weekes book. I am finding extremely helpful even though I haven't read it from cover to cover I find I am able to concentrate more if I pick sections from it (if that makes sense) rather than being faced with a whole book to read ha ha.

I find that when I am feeling anxious and/or panicky I can recall excerpts from the book which is making me less afraid of the panic. She talks a lot about over sensitization which is helping me understand why minor things seem to catastrophic to me which is reassuring so I would definitely say that it was well worth buying obviously it won't cure my anxiety or agoraphobia but it is making me less afraid of it.

Oh one thing though should I have bought self-help for your nerves also? Does this give you practical ways of helping your anxiety?
